#6dd452 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6dd452 is composed of 42.7% red, 83.1%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 61.3%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 107.5 degrees, a saturation of 60.2% and a lightness of 57.6%. #6dd452 color hex could be obtained by blending #daffa4 with #00a900.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

#6dd452 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6dd452 has RGB values of R:109, G:212, B:82 and CMYK values of C:0.49, M:0, Y:0.61,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 7197778.

Shades and Tints of #6dd452
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#061004 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#6dd452
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8f9a8c is the less saturated color, while #55fe28 is the most saturated one.
